I have an old panasonic minidv camcorder (model no. pv-6529) that I only use to watch the tapes with my television since there doesn't seems to be a cheaper method. Well, yesterday the battery ran out so I charged the battery with a wall adapter and thought I had the correct 7.9v power adapter. So I plugged it into the camcorder and nothing happened. Now that my battery is charged it will not turn on the camcorder. I have read several blogs about this and believe I blew out a fuse/cicuit. I would like to attempt to repair myself since the camcorder was purchased more than 5 years ago (spent about $300) but don't know where to start. How can I determine if its a fuse and if I determine its a fuse, where do I purchase that? Should I also try purchasing the 7.9v power adapter to see if that works vs. running off the battery?
